Motown Pays Their Respect at Teena Marie Memorial
The world lost Teena Marie on Dec. 26 at the age of 54, and Motown paid tribute to her one last time. During a two-hour private ceremony yesterday, Stevie Wonder, Smokey Robinson, Berry Gordy Jr., Shanice Wilson and Queen Latifah all paid respect to the late singer at Los Angeles' Forest Lawn Memorial Park, celebrating the Ivory Queen of Soul...

ASCAP Pays Homage to King of Pop, Honors Alicia Keys, The Dream
The American Society of Composers, Authors and Publishers honored Alicia Keys, The Dream, and soul legend Smokey Robinson at its 22nd annual awards ceremony Friday. The event, which was held at the Beverly Hilton in Los Angeles, recognized its winners for their musical contributions, yet the main topic on everyone's mind was the death of pop icon, Michael Jackson...
